Output 3141a0cac2f94a39a024d04feb3d99028a088d28f40e3bfa6a32933a2fe7de2e:1

value
21483153
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cfba238e32e444660d46e0e671a56b70d9dcb72 OP_EQUAL
address
37FTusJvghFdZG5YoRNx3T5xG5FgCF6kGc
transaction
3141a0cac2f94a39a024d04feb3d99028a088d28f40e3bfa6a32933a2fe7de2e
confirmations
263691
spent
true